Three weeks after Jio announced its disruptive tariffs, Airtel, Vodafone and Idea haven't lowered prices of their own offerings. Airtel has suggested that they may wait to take a decision on tariffs only at the end of the year, once Jio's free services come to an end. For now customers of Jio competitors are seeing response on a case by case basis, when they make mobile number porting requests. In such cases, Airtel, Vodafone and Jio are offering these customers higher usage plans at lower prices. LiveMint

NSEL director Jignesh Shah was arrested by the CBI following raids at his home and offices. The federal agency also carried out searches of five current and former SEBI officials. The FIR filed by the CBI names these SEBI officials as part of their investigation. BS

The price war has begun for this festival season, as Snapdeal takes on Flipkart with the 'Unbox Diwali' sale which starts on October 2. Flipkart will begin its sale over the same period, starting October 1. Both retailers will be announcing discounts upwards of 70%. Amazon has yet to announce its discount sale dates. Firstpost
